An application offering digital photo booth capabilities on the Android operating system, considered superior to others, provides users with a range of features. These typically include customizable templates, real-time filters, digital props, and sharing options for social media platforms. For example, a user might utilize such an application at a party to create personalized, branded photographs for attendees to instantly share online.
The availability of such applications enhances user engagement and adds an interactive element to events or personal use. Their popularity stems from the ease of creating memorable visual content without requiring specialized equipment or professional photography services. Historically, physical photo booths were bulky and expensive; these applications offer a convenient, cost-effective alternative, democratizing access to photo booth experiences.

Tip 1: Prioritize User Interface Evaluation: Before committing to an application, thoroughly assess its ease of use. Navigate through the menus, experiment with different features, and ensure the workflow is intuitive. An application with a complex or confusing interface will hinder productivity and diminish the overall experience. Evaluate whether the icons are clear, the text is legible, and the overall layout is logical.
Tip 2: Examine Filter Variety and Customization: A comprehensive range of filters allows for greater creative expression. Investigate the stylistic diversity of available filters and assess the extent to which they can be customized. Can the intensity be adjusted? Are there options for color correction or special effects? An application offering extensive filter options empowers users to create visually appealing and unique images.
Tip 3: Assess Sharing Capabilities: Efficient sharing options are paramount for disseminating generated content. Ensure the application integrates seamlessly with popular social media platforms, cloud storage services, and email providers. The ability to quickly and easily share photos and videos enhances user engagement and extends the reach of created content. Determine if the application supports direct posting to various platforms and if resolution settings can be adjusted for optimal sharing.
Tip 4: Investigate Template Customization Options: Customizable templates provide users with a starting point for creative designs. Explore the degree to which templates can be modified, including layout adjustments, graphic element integration, and text customization. The ability to personalize templates ensures that generated content aligns with specific events or preferences. Ascertain whether the template options support branding elements or event-specific information.
Tip 5: Evaluate Performance and Stability: The reliability of an application is crucial for a positive user experience. Before committing, conduct performance tests to assess stability and responsiveness. Does the application crash frequently? Are there noticeable delays in image processing or filter application? A superior application delivers consistent and dependable performance across a variety of Android devices.
Tip 6: Scrutinize Output Resolution: High-resolution output guarantees visual clarity, especially for printing images or displaying them on larger screens. Determine the maximum image resolution supported by the application. Lower resolutions compromise image quality and limit printing capabilities. Verify that the application offers options for adjusting the output resolution based on intended use.
Tip 7: Check for Recent and Regular Updates: Applications that receive regular updates demonstrate a commitment to ongoing improvement and compatibility with the latest Android versions. Review the application’s update history in the Google Play Store. Frequent updates indicate that the developer is actively addressing bugs, enhancing performance, and introducing new features.
